CVE-2020-9726

MEDIUMCVSS 6.1/10EPSS 2.75%

Last modified

CVE-2020-9726 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 6.1/10 on the CVSS scale. Adobe FrameMaker version 2019.0.6 (and earlier versions) has an out-of-bounds read vulnerability that could be exploited to read past the end of an allocated buffer, possibly resulting in a crash or disclosure of sensitive information from other memory locations.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ious FrameMaker file.. EPSS estimates a 2.75%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
